Understanding Blockchain Technology

At its core, blockchain technology stands as the backbone of cryptocurrencies. It represents a decentralized ledger that records transactions across many computers, ensuring that records cannot be altered retroactively. Think of it like a digital diary that everyone can read but no one can rewrite. This feature is what provides transparency and fosters trust among users. Many cryptocurrencies operate on their own blockchains, but variations exist that enrich this framework.

The mechanics of blockchain involve multiple layers of security, primarily through cryptographic measures. Each block of data links to the previous one, forming a chain – hence the term ā€˜blockchain’. This ensures that any attempt to change information requires altering all subsequent blocks, a near-impossible feat.

Key Concepts in Cryptocurrency Trading

Navigating cryptocurrency trading is akin to learning a new language; it takes time, patience, and practice. A few terms that every trader should firmly grasp include:

  • Market Capitalization: This indicates the total value of a cryptocurrency, calculated by multiplying the current price by the total number of coins in circulation.
  • Liquidity: Referring to how easily an asset can be bought or sold without affecting its price, liquidity is crucial for making swift trades.
  • Volatility: This is a double-edged sword in the crypto world. While high volatility can lead to significant profit opportunities, it also poses a risk for losses.

Technical Analysis Techniques

Diving deeper, technical analysis emerges as a powerful tool for dissecting CXO stock behaviors. This approach hinges on analyzing historical price data and trading volumes to predict future movements. Investors utilize charts, indicators, and patterns to gauge market sentiment. Commonly used tools include:

  • Moving Averages: This technique smooths out price data over a specified time frame, helping to identify trends and reversals.
  • Relative Strength Index (RSI): This momentum indicator compares the magnitude of recent gains to recent losses, signaling whether a stock is overbought or oversold.
  • Bollinger Bands: These bands encompass price action and indicate volatility, often signaling potential price swings.
  • Fibonacci Retracement: This methodology helps identify support and resistance levels based on the Fibonacci sequence, which can indicate possible reversal areas.

By interlacing these techniques, investors can formulate interpretations about CXO stock that could be pivotal in a time of volatility. However, it’s crucial to approach these tools with a critical eye, as past performances do not always assure future results.
